Energy Extraction

In energy extraction, electrical energy is converted and stored within chemical bonds or high-purity raw materials. This process occurs under extreme physical conditions. In copper refining, for example, only an absolutely uniform current distribution via specialized busbars can guarantee the purity of the end product.

Our engineers prioritize busbars

Due to their large surface area, busbars dissipate heat much more efficiently than cables do. They also allow for a more compact design of switchgear and connection areas.

Hydrogen electrolysis

To split water into its components, electrolyzers (PEM or alkaline) are supplied with direct current (DC). At industrial scales, the currents push conventional cable solutions to their physical limits. Busbars ensure a low-loss connection between rectifiers and stacks in these cases.

Aluminum electrolysis

Aluminum production is one of the most energy-intensive processes worldwide. Aluminum oxide is melted at high temperatures in electrolytic cells. Currents of 300 to over 500 kA are common. Even minimal resistance in the supply line would result in significant energy loss and uncontrolled heat generation.

Copper electrolysis

Precision is paramount in copper refining. To achieve a purity level of over 99.9%, the current must be distributed evenly across the anodes and cathodes. Busbars ensure consistent current flow throughout the electrolysis tanks, enabling successful energy extraction.

Precision in Contacting and Materials

The focus should be on the details, specifically the contact points. With currents in the kiloampere range, even a minor connection issue can create a hotspot that endangers the entire plant. Our modern, high-current systems use bimetallic CoppAl®(Cuponal Al/Cu), which combines the lightweight benefits of aluminum with the superior conductivity of copper.

Additionally, flexible busbars, such as braids or lamellas, are often used to compensate for thermal expansion and vibrations in electrolysis cells without putting stress on the connections. We also typically use surface finishing with silver- or tin-plated contact surfaces to minimize transition resistance.
